Transaction ffe7c23294bd93f3b80508120bdabe39dd08e4784af285778f381db3f962b73d
1 Input
1 Output
-
ffe7c23294bd93f3b80508120bdabe39dd08e4784af285778f381db3f962b73d:0
- value
- 21128839
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b2c691cc8911768f70ee2fbb13a3a8c3d1d07d16 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HJH9zukj9WvgTVkHJnrMyH7yZmW1NrMwv